Summary

Step into the enchanting world of "The Tale of Tom Kitten" by Beatrix Potter, a delightful and whimsical story that brings to life the adventures of Tom Kitten and his mischievous siblings.

Meet Tom Kitten, a curious young cat who, along with his sisters Moppet and Mittens, finds himself in a series of comical predicaments. As they prepare to meet their mother's guests for tea, their clean attire is put to the test, resulting in a delightful tale of mishaps, laughter, and valuable life lessons.

Beatrix Potter's storytelling is a delightful blend of humor, warmth, and the charm of childhood. The tale unfolds amidst enchanting illustrations that vividly portray the antics of the kittens, immersing you in the lively world of these adorable feline characters.

The illustrations in this tale are a testament to Beatrix Potter's artistic talent, capturing the expressions and quirks of each character, as well as the coziness of their home, with intricate detail and charm. Each page is a visual delight that complements the engaging narrative.

"The Tale of Tom Kitten" is a beloved classic that continues to captivate readers of all ages, offering timeless lessons about mischief, family, and the importance of being true to oneself.     Kipling, that master storyteller, here weaves a marvelous story of heroism by Kotick, a rare white-furred seal. As a young seal he sees thousands of his fellow seals being clubbed to death by islanders for their skins every year. Kolick decides to do something about this and searches for a safe home where his people can mate and raise their young. After several years of searching as he comes of age, he eventually finds another suitable place in the Bering Sea. With much difficulty he persuades some of the other seals to follow him to a safe place that the hunters do not know of and where they will not be clubbed or shot.
